Before we dive into the details, let’s first define what Impala cars are. Impala is a full-size car model that has been produced by Chevrolet since 1957. It is known for its sleek design, spacious interior, and powerful engine. Over the years, Impala has undergone several transformations, and today it is one of the most sought-after cars in the market.

Specifications

Engine and Performance

The latest Impala models come with a 2.5-liter four-cylinder engine that produces 197 horsepower and 191 lb-ft of torque. This engine is paired with a six-speed automatic transmission and front-wheel drive. The Impala also offers a more powerful 3.6-liter V6 engine that generates 305 horsepower and 264 lb-ft of torque. This engine is available on higher trims and provides a more exhilarating driving experience.

When it comes to fuel efficiency, the Impala is relatively impressive for its size, with an EPA-estimated 22 miles per gallon in the city and 30 miles per gallon on the highway.

Interior and Exterior

The Impala boasts a spacious and comfortable interior, with plenty of room for passengers and cargo. It can comfortably seat up to five adults, and the trunk has a generous capacity of 18.8 cubic feet. The interior also features high-quality materials and advanced technology, such as an infotainment system with an eight-inch touchscreen display, Apple CarPlay, and Android Auto.

On the exterior, the Impala has a sleek and modern design, with a bold grille, sharp lines, and distinctive headlights. The car is available in several colors, including Silver Ice Metallic, Black, and Cajun Red Tintcoat.

Safety Features

The Impala is equipped with a range of safety features that ensure your safety and that of your passengers. Some of these features include a rearview camera, lane departure warning, forward collision alert, and rear cross-traffic alert.

Advantages and Disadvantages

Advantages

One of the biggest advantages of the Impala is its spacious and comfortable interior. It is perfect for families or anyone who values comfort and space. The car also offers a smooth and quiet ride, thanks to its advanced suspension system and sound insulation.

The Impala’s powerful engine options and impressive fuel efficiency are also a plus. Whether you opt for the four-cylinder engine or the V6, you can expect a responsive and engaging driving experience.

Another advantage of the Impala is its advanced safety features. The car has been awarded a five-star overall safety rating by the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ration (NHTSA), making it one of the safest cars in its class.

Disadvantages

One of the main disadvantages of the Impala is its size. While it offers plenty of space for passengers and cargo, it can be difficult to maneuver in tight spaces or narrow streets. The car’s large size can also be a challenge when it comes to parking or finding a suitable parking spot.

Another disadvantage of the Impala is its price. While it offers many advanced features and a high level of comfort, it is relatively expensive compared to other cars in its class.

Impala Cars for Sale: Complete Information

Model Engine Transmission Price Range
Impala LS 2.5-liter four-cylinder or 3.6-liter V6 Six-speed automatic $31,620 – $36,720
Impala LT 2.5-liter four-cylinder or 3.6-liter V6 Six-speed automatic $33,120 – $38,220
Impala Premier 2.5-liter four-cylinder or 3.6-liter V6 Six-speed automatic $37,620 – $42,720

6. What is the warranty on the Impala?

The Impala comes with a three-year/36,000-mile basic warranty and a five-year/60,000-mile powertrain warranty.
